When I told my mom I had cancer she said her heart was broken and that she wished it was her instead of me. You see, no mom wants her child to be in pain no matter how old her child is. Even as an adult dealing with cancer and experiencing the discomfort and pain of treatment I cannot even begin to fathom what a child going through cancer treatment is enduring. I’m very lucky that I feel strong physically, mentally and spiritually. Fortunately, I’ve had many years' experience to help me feel this way. A child hasn’t had the luxury of time or experience to learn to deal positively with cancer treatment but somehow they manage. As a mom, my heart goes out to mothers with children battling cancer; I now have an inkling of how they feel. This is why I chose to be a shavee and this is why I need your support to help Conquer Kids’ Cancer. My motto: I WILL SURVIVE and I truly believe that I WILL. Sincerely, Linda
